Door Track Replacement in Olathe, KS
Door track replacement services involve updating or repairing the metal or wooden tracks that guide sliding or pocket doors within a property.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ing worn or damaged tracks, realigning misaligned tracks, and installing new tracks to improve the smooth operation of doors. Homeowners often request this service when their sliding doors become difficult to open or close, or if there are visible signs of wear, rust, or damage that may compromise door functionality and security.

Door Track Replacement Questions
What is door track replacement? It involves removing and installing new tracks to ensure smooth operation of sliding or pocket doors.
When should door tracks be replaced? Replacement is needed if the door is sticking, difficult to open, or the track is damaged or bent.
What types of doors can benefit from track replacement? Sliding glass doors, pocket doors, and barn doors often require track replacement for proper function.
How does track replacement improve door performance? It restores smooth sliding, reduces noise, and prevents door misalignment or falling off the track.
